CleverDevs – Telegram
CleverDevs
8.45K subscribers
734 photos
283 videos
27 files
436 links
به کانال کلوردوز خوش اومدین

سعی میکنیم چیزایی که بنظر کاربردی هستن رو باهاتون به اشتراک بزاریم


🔥لینوکس
🔥برنامه نویسی فرانت‌اند
🔥برنامه نویسی بک‌اند
🔥اخبار تکنولوژی و...

CleverDevs are better than other Devs
💢~> @mmdrsdev
Download Telegram
CleverDevs
توی ورژن 10.10.0 تلگرام (فعلا بتا) دوتا بخش جدید برای پروفایل اضافه شده یکی چنل شخصیتون و یکی تاریخ تولد قسمت چنله بنظرم باحال و بدرد بخوره #telegram #news @CleverDevs - @CleverDevsGp
یسری قابلیت هم برای تلگرام بیزنس اومده فقط همین یکی رو میزارم

میتونید مثل بات ها همچین چیزی برا اکانتتون بزارید

که متاسفانه تلگرام پرمیوم میخواد

#telegram #news
@CleverDevs - @CleverDevsGp
👍17🔥102
Forwarded from HICTE Blog (smm)
#خبر

ظاهرا توی ورژن های 1-5.6.0 و 1-5.6.1 پکیج xz یه backdoor پیدا شده و توصیه میشه به ورژن جدید (2-5.6.1) آپگرید کنید ⚠️:
# pacman -Syu

توضیحات تکمیلی:
https://archlinux.org/news/the-xz-package-has-been-backdoored/

🚁 Hicte Blog
👍10👌3
This media is not supported in your browser
VIEW IN TELEGRAM
جاوااسکریپت است دیگر. 🫱🏽‍🫲🏽

#fun
@CleverDevs - @CleverDevsGp
🤣51👍4💔3👎1
This media is not supported in your browser
VIEW IN TELEGRAM
ویژگی جدید سی‌اس‌اس @scope خیلی خفنه🔥.

باهاش میتونید یه المنت رو انتخاب کنید و داخلش به چایلدهاش استایل بدید که یسری مشکلات مربوط به specifity سلکتور‌ها رو برطرف میکنه (تو ویدیو مشخصه).

@scope (root) to (exception) {
/* styles */
}

// وضعیت ساپورت مرورگرش خوب نیست فعلا.

Source
@CleverDevs - @CleverDevsGp
🆒163👍3❤‍🔥1🔥1
💢 آپدیت جدید تلگرام؛

1- گزینه درآمد زایی(monetization) اومده و فقط مالک چنل‌ها میتونن از قسمت تنظیمات کانال مقدار درآمد چنل رو ببینن و با Ton برداشت کنن.

2- میتونید ربات یا کانالتون رو داخل تلگرام(چنل‌ها) تبلیغ بدید و انتخاب کنید بنرتون تو چه چنل‌هایی نمایش داده شه.

3- میتونید کانال هایی که دارید رو به پروفایتون اضافه کنید تا بقیه هم ببینن.

4- میتونید تاریخ تولدتون رو به پروفایلتون اضافه کنید و تلگرام روز تولدتون به بقیه نوتیفیکیشن میفرسته که تولدتونه.

#news #telegram
@CleverDevs - @CleverDevsGp
👍28🔥92😁2🆒21
توی پایتون همه دیتاها با آبحکت ها یا ارتباط بین آبجکت ها نشون داده میشن ; عجب زبونیه ، همش آبجکته. چیزایی مثل list , string , function توی پایتون آبجکت هستن

بر همین اساس ما یه تابع که آبجکت هست رو میتونم مثل هر ابجکت دیگه ای بریزیم توی یه متغیر دیگه یه نگاه به این کد بندازید
def yell(text):
return text.upper() + '!'

>>> yell("cleverdevs")
CLEVERDEVS


حالا میایم این تابع رو میریزیم توی یه تابع دیگه
bark = yell

>>> bark('mammad')
MAMMAD


دیدم که فانکشن دوم هم مث اولی درست حسابی کار میکنه اما اگه بیایم فانکشن اصلی رو با کلیدواژه del پاک کنیم چی میشه ؟
>>> del yell
>>> yell('hello?')
NameError: "name 'yell' is not defined"
>>> bark('hey')
'HEY!'


حالا پایتون میاد و به هر فانکشنی که میسازید یه هویت میده که میتونید با اتریبیوت name بهش دسترسی داشته باشید


>>> bark.__name__
'yell'




همونطور که میبینید هویت فانکشن bark همون yell شد چون که دقیقا یه ابجکت رو کپی کردیم رو متغیر جدید پس اتریبیوت هاش هم تغییری نکردن
اما با اینکه name اسم فانکشن اصلی رو برمیگردونه تغییر تو نحوه صدا زدن فانکشن bark برامون ایجاد نمیشه
درواقع name برای دیباگ کردن بدرد میخوره

#python
@CleverDevs - @CleverDevsGp
👍22🔥4👌31
This media is not supported in your browser
VIEW IN TELEGRAM
ریز برنامه‌نویسی از راه رسید😄

#fun
@CleverDevs - @CleverDevsGp
😁29🤣12💔4👍1👎1
اقا سیزده بدره برای #بحث_امشب دروغ های سیزده/اول آوریل بگید
درباره برنامه نویسی باشه

مثلا جاوااسکریپت منطقی ترین زبون دنیاس

@CleverDevs - @CleverDevsGp
👌24🤣6👎4👍2
💢 سیستم عامل تحت اینترنت!

پوتر(puter) یک سیستم عامل تحت وب قدرتمند، سریع و ایمنی هستش که توسط توسعه دهنده ایرانی Nariman Jelveh خلق شده، پوتر شمارو قادر میکنه از هرجا و هر دستگاهی به سیستم عامل شخصی خودتون دسترسی داشته باشید؛ همچنین با استفاده از زبان جاوااسکریپت و گو نوشته شده و قابلیت سلف هاستینگ هم داره.

شماهم براحتی میتونید وارد وبسایت Puter شده و ثبت نام رو عرض چند ثانیه به پایان برسونید و این پروژه خارق العاده رو تجربه کنید.

#OS
@CleverDevs - @CleverDevsGp
🔥48❤‍🔥4👎32👍2
همینا میرن میشن وزیر ارتباطات 😂

#fun
@CleverDevs - @CleverDevsGp
🤣90😁8👎3👍2
بزار من برات گوگل کنم 😕

احتمالا بارها شاهد سوال های افرادی که ترس از گوگل دارند و هیچ موقع نمیخوان باهاش روبرو بشن شدید، با این پروژه که توسط جادی عزیز به فارسی ترجمه و هاست شده میتونید متنی که پرسشگر باید سرچ میکرد رو داخلش تایپ کنید و سایت بهتون یک لینکی میده که ارسال میکنید به یوزر و با وارد شدن بهش، تایپ شدن متن رو میبینه و بعدش هم کلیک روی گزینه سرچ و سپس با متن تنظیم شده منتقل میشه به صفحه اصلی گوگل و نتیجه هارو میبینه.

آدرس وبسایت: bmbgk.ir
باشد که سرچگر شوید...

#fun
@CleverDevs - @CleverDevsGp
👌38😁11👍5🔥2👎1
توی گیت یه فایل معروف .gitignore داریم که میتونیم توش فایل ها یا پوشه های رو مشخص کنیم تا گیت اونارو در نظر نگیره
اکثرا ما میایم تو همون روت پروژمون یه فایل gitignore. میسازیم 

اما گاها میخوایم یسری پوشه ها مثل idea. که برای ادیتور های جت برینزه یا فایل های swp ویم همیشه ایگنور بشن
برای اینکار میتونیم یه فایل gitignore گلوبال ست کنیم

برای ست کردن global gitignore اول یه فایل میسازیم

touch ~/.gitignore


بعد با دستور زیر به گیت معرفیش میگنیم

git config --global core.excludesFile ~/.gitignore


یا میتونید جای کامند بالا بیایید دستی به gitconfig./~ اضافش کنید

[core]
  excludesFile = ~/.gitignore



#git
@CleverDevs - @CleverDevsGp
👍33🔥732
آرچ یوزر بودن اونجاش سخته که بعضیا نمیدونن آرچ یوزر هستی😂

// اینو برا دانشجو پزشکیا گفته بودن فورکش کردم عوض کردم😁


#fun
@CleverDevs - @CleverDevsGp
🤣58😁5👌2
شاید براتون سوال باشه وقتی داخل تلگرام(و سایر پلتفرما) لینک سایت یا یوتیوب و اینستا که میدیم چطور اون تیتر و توضیحات و عکس نشون داده میشه و تکنولوژی پشتش چیه.

حوالی سال ۲۰۱۰ فیسبوک اومد پروتکل اوپن گراف (open graph) رو راه‌اندازی کرد تا از سایر پلتفرم ها به نوعی حمایت کرده باشه و لینک هایی که داخل پلتفرم خودش ارسال میشه هم زیبا دیده شه. و حالا اکثر سایت ها ازش استفاده میکنن تا بازدیدکنندگان بیشتری جذب کنن.

نمونه تگ:
<meta property="og:noscript" content="Clever Devs"/>


#OpenGraph
@CleverDevs - @CleverDevs
🔥34👍13💯2🆒2
برگرفته شده از داستان واقعی..

#fun
@CleverDevs - @CleverDevsGp
🤣102😁5👍2💯2